JAMAICA — A man was shot to death in Queens just minutes before noon on Sunday, FDNY officials said.

Rescuers responded to a call at 11:56 a.m. from 107-19 171st Pl. in Jamaica, to find a 21-year-old man who had been shot to the head.

Rescuers pronounced the victim dead at the scene.

Identification of the victim is pending family notification.

It was not clear what sparked the shooting.
